Installation Instructions READ BEFORE INSTALLING UNIT OPP5K Window Mounting Your air conditioner is designed to install in standard double hung windows with opening widths of 23 to 36 inches (584 mm to 914 mm) (FIG. 1) Lower sash must open sufficiently to allow a clear vertical opening of 14-1/2 inches (368 mm). Side louvers and the rear of the AC must have clear air space to allow enough airflow through the condenser, for heat removal. The rear of the unit must be outdoors, not inside a building or garage. Fig. 1 CAUTION When handling unit, be careful to avoid cuts from sharp metal edges and aluminum fins on front and rear coils. Before installing unit, the top rail must be assembled on the unit. Top Rail Hardware Qty. 3/8" Screw 4 Top Rail 1 NOTE: SAVE CARTON and these IN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S for future reference. The carton is the best way to store unit during winter, or when not in use. Some assembly is required. Please read these instructions carefully. Mounting Hardware 3/4"screws Qty. 7 lock frame 2 sash lock 1 TOOL NEEDED: Phillips Screwdriver A. Remove the air conditioner from the carton and place on a flat surface. B. Remove top rail from the bottom of the packaging material as shown in Fig. A C. Align the hole in the top rail with those in the top of the unit as shown in Fig. B D. Secure the top rail to the unit with the 3/8" Screws as shown in Fig. C Packaging Fig. A Top Rail Fig. B Fig. C TOOLS NEEDED: Phillips Screw Driver Drill (If pilot holes are needed) NOTE: FOR SAFETY REASONS, ALL FOUR (4) SCREWS MUST BE SECURELY FASTENED. 1 P/N 66129901121
